Description
WDR72 encodes a protein containing WD40 repeats, which are involved in protein-protein interactions. It is essential for enamel maturation during tooth development and has been implicated in kidney function. Mutations in WDR72 cause autosomal recessive amelogenesis imperfecta type 2A3 and are associated with nephrocalcinosis.
Disease Associations
| Disease category | Pathophysiological mechanism | Genomic evidence |
|---|---|---|
| Amelogenesis Imperfecta Type 2A3 (AI2A3) | Loss-of-function mutations disrupt enamel maturation, leading to hypomaturation enamel defects. | OMIM #613214; ClinVar |
| Nephrocalcinosis | WDR72 mutations impair endosomal recycling in kidney cells, causing calcium deposition. | OMIM #613214; PubMed studies |

Protein Summary
WDR72 is a 1,102-amino-acid protein with multiple WD40 repeats that facilitate protein interactions. It localizes to endosomes and is involved in vesicle trafficking, critical for enamel matrix protein degradation and kidney ion transport.
